Online prep courses for the GMAT and SAT are digital learning programs designed to help students prepare effectively for these standardized tests. They typically include video lectures, practice questions, full-length practice exams, personalized study plans, and interactive features to enhance learning flexibility and accessibility from any location with an internet connection.

Pros
- High flexibility allows learners to study at their own pace
- Access to a wide range of practice materials and resources
- Cost-effective compared to in-person tutoring
- Up-to-date content aligned with current exam formats
- Convenient for busy or remote learners
Cons
- Less personal interaction with instructors compared to traditional classes
- Requires disciplined self-motivation to stay on track
- Varying quality among different providers
- Potential technical issues or platform limitations
- Some courses may lack customized feedback experienced in face-to-face tutoring
